Businesses can pursue collections through demand letters, negotiation, mediation, or litigation; each path has different timelines, costs, and risks.
In straightforward cases, early demand letters and negotiated settlements may resolve the matter without court action.
When customers respond quickly and terms are clear, a limited approach can save time and costs.
Older debts or complex disputes often require a combination of letters, negotiations, and potential court action.

The process begins with a review of your invoices, terms, and the debtor’s history to determine collectability. We outline a plan, including demand letters, negotiation, and potential court action, while keeping you informed.
A collections attorney provides knowledge of California collection laws, strategies for effective communication, and filings when required. We manage the process so you can focus on running your business.
Initial case assessment, demand letters, negotiations, and possible lawsuit are typical steps. Documentation and timely follow ups are crucial to a successful outcome.
Litigation is considered when other efforts fail to secure payment or when the amount justifies the cost. We assess risk, costs, and likelihood of success with you.
Timing varies based on debt age, debtor cooperation, and court availability. We provide regular updates and adjust the plan as needed.
Pursuing collections can impact relationships if communications are aggressive; we aim for respectful, compliant actions. We balance firmness with courtesy to preserve business ties whenever possible.
Fees can be hourly, flat, or contingent depending on the arrangement and the stage of collection. We discuss costs upfront and tailor a plan that fits your budget.
If a debt is disputed, we gather supporting documents and work toward resolution. Disputes may delay collection until facts are clarified.
